WebApr 5, 2024 · A home AC flush costs $75 to $250 to unclog the condensate drain line. Mold, mildew, dirt, and debris cause clogs in the drain line. If the drain line is not flushed regularly to prevent clogs, water collected in the drain pan overflows, causing water damage. To prevent clogs, pour 1/4 cup of distilled white vinegar in the drain line every month. WebCall us toll free at 1-888-295-2009 or instant-chat with us Mondays through Saturdays. Air Conditioners Furnaces Heat Pumps Ductless Systems More Products … did i lose my soulWebApr 5, 2024 · People can continue to use air-conditioning (AC) equipment that uses HCFC-22, whether it is a window unit or a central cooling system. EPA does not require homeowners to replace their existing equipment.
